期刊简介:The Current Opinion journals were developed out of the recognition that it is increasingly difficult for specialists to keep up to date with the expanding volume of information published in their subject. In Current Opinion in Environmental Sustainability, we help the reader by providing in a systematic manner:1. The views of experts on current advances in environmental sustainability in a clear and readable form.2. Evaluations of the most interesting papers, annotated by experts, from the great wealth of original publications.Current Opinion in Environmental Sustainability aims to track the emergence of a new innovative sustainability science discipline by integrating across regional and global systems with their typical dimensions, human-environment interactions and management challenges. Current Opinion in Environmental Sustainability thus emphasises the actual interdisciplinary sustainability research approaches, the solutions it provides and their dissemination and application.The subject of environmental sustainability is divided into 6 themed annual issues. Each theme helps to identify, understand and solve sustainability problems and are not mutually exclusive. The overlap results from the actual complexity of combining all the sustainability science dimensions and approaches. The themes are:1. Environmental change issues;2. Environmental change assessments;3. System dynamics and sustainability;4. Sustainability governance and transformation;5. Sustainability challenges;6. Sustainability science.
【译文】当前观点期刊的设立源于认识到专家们越来越难以跟上他们学科领域内不断增长的出版信息量。在《当前观点环境可持续性》中,我们通过系统的方式帮助读者:1. 以清晰易读的形式提供专家对环境可持续性当前进展的观点。2. 对大量原创出版物中最有趣的论文进行评估,并由专家注释。当前观点环境可持续性旨在通过整合区域和全球系统及其典型维度、人地相互作用和管理挑战,追踪新兴的创新可持续科学学科的兴起。因此,当前观点环境可持续性强调实际的跨学科可持续性研究方法、它提供的解决方案及其传播和应用。环境可持续性主题分为6个年度专题问题。每个主题有助于识别、理解和解决可持续性问题,它们不是相互排斥的。重叠源于将所有可持续科学维度和方法结合的实际复杂性。主题包括:1. 环境变化问题;2. 环境变化评估;3. 系统动力学与可持续性;4. 可持续治理与转型;5. 可持续挑战;6. 可持续科学。
